Description
This is one of those flats that just feels good the moment you walk in.
It’s a two-bedroom, lower ground floor place on a really nice end-of-terrace building, literally a 4-minute walk from Shepherd’s Bush (Central Line), so super easy for getting around. But what makes it stand out is how much work has gone into it — the owners bought it completely unmodernised and have basically rebuilt it from scratch, and it shows. Everything feels clean, well thought out, and properly finished.
Even though it’s lower ground, it’s surprisingly bright. They’ve landscaped the front garden in a way that brings loads of light in, so it never feels dark or basement-y. At the back, you’ve got a private garden that’s perfect for morning coffee or having friends over when the weather’s decent.
The layout works really well — two genuinely good-sized bedrooms (not box-room compromises), a really nicely done bathroom, and then an open-plan kitchen/living space at the back that opens straight out onto the garden. It’s the kind of setup that just works for everyday living, whether that’s quiet nights in or having people round.
It’s also share of freehold, which is a big plus, and the building itself is a lovely period conversion.
